Here's a timeline of what's been going on with the second stimulus check
July 2020 - Senate Republicans and House Democrats have issued competing bills on a possible second stimulus check for Americans.
July 15, 2020 The HEALS Act is the Senate Republican proposal. It has a $1 trillion price tag that also offers another round of $1,200 payments as well as $500 for child and adult dependents alike. It also reduces the amount of additional unemployment Americans would receive from $600 to $200.

September 20 - Democratic Senator Catherine Cortez Masto called the bill an "insult to the American people" and said it lacked "critical funding" to individuals, medical facilities and state and local governments.
October 2020 - Donald Trump says stimulus relief negotiations over until after he wins the November 3rd election.
October 2020 - trump said he was ready to sign a "standalone bill" authorizing distribution of direct stimulus ($1,200) payments to individuals "immediately."
Dec 16, 2020- The likelihood of another payment being approved before the end of the year grows dimmer by the day. Instead, it's more likely that a second stimulus check would arrive in early 2021, despite a chorus of voices that would prefer to include a payment for $600 or $1,200.
Dec 24, 2020 - Trump is delaying the bill and asking Congress to raise the second stimulus check up to $2,000. Payments will not be sent out until the bill gets signed into law.
Dec 25, 2020 - The fate of the $900 billion economic relief package hangs in the balance after House Republicans blocked Democrats from raising stimulus payments for millions of Americans from $600 to $2,000.
Dec 25, 2020 - The second stimulus check payments are in turmoil once again.
